Ultimately, opting for legal streaming platforms is a much better alternative to searching for free downloads. Today, platforms like Spotify, Apple Music, YouTube Music, and JioSaavn host extensive catalogs of 90s Telugu classics in pristine, high-definition audio. Many of these services offer free, ad-supported tiers, allowing fans to enjoy their favorite nostalgic hits without spending a penny or breaking the law. By choosing to stream legally, listeners ensure a safe device experience, enjoy superior sound quality, and directly support the preservation of Telugu cinema's rich musical heritage. The melodies of the 90s are timeless treasures, and they deserve to be experienced in the best and most respectful way possible.

Despite the intense desire to own these classic tracks, clicking on links promising "free downloads" poses significant drawbacks. Legally and ethically, downloading copyrighted music from unauthorized websites constitutes piracy. It denies creators, music labels, and the families of veteran artists the royalties they rightfully deserve. Furthermore, these illegal download sites are often hotbeds for malware, intrusive advertisements, and low-quality audio rips. Listening to a masterpiece by A.R. Rahman or M.M. Keeravani in a compressed, crackling 128kbps format ruins the rich instrumentation and vocal dynamics that the artists worked so hard to perfect.
The decade from 1990 to 2000 is widely considered a renaissance for Telugu film music. With composers like ( Kshana Kshanam , Annamayya ), A. R. Rahman ( Rangeela – dubbed, Dil Se – Telugu), Raj–Koti , Vandemataram Srinivas , and S. A. Rajkumar , the era produced timeless melodies and folk-driven energy. Songs like "O Papa Lali" (from Allari Priyudu ), "Ghantadi Ghal Ghal" ( Tholiprema ), and "Chandamama Raave" ( Kalisundam Raa ) remain benchmarks.
